 Jasper National Park:

Jasper National Park is a UNESCO World Heritage Site located in the Canadian Rockies in Alberta, Canada. It covers an area of 11,000 square kilometers and is the largest national park in the Canadian Rockies. The park is home to a variety of wildlife, including elk, deer, moose, bighorn sheep, mountain goats, wolves, bears, and more. It's also home to over 1,000 species of plants and several glaciers.

One of the park's most famous attractions is Maligne Lake, which is a glacial lake with turquoise waters and surrounded by mountains. It's a popular spot for hiking, canoeing, kayaking, and fishing. Spirit Island, located in the middle of the lake, is one of the most photographed spots in Canada.

Another popular attraction in Jasper National Park is the Icefields Parkway, which is a scenic highway that connects Jasper and Banff National Parks. It offers stunning views of glaciers, waterfalls, and wildlife, and is considered one of the most beautiful drives in the world.

Jasper National Park also offers several hiking trails for all skill levels. Some of the most popular hikes include the Sulphur Skyline Trail, the Valley of the Five Lakes Trail, and the Edith Cavell Meadows Trail. Google Search Location

Here are some of the top things to do and places to visit in Jasper National Park:

  • Maligne Lake: This stunning glacial lake is surrounded by mountains and offers a variety of activities, including boat tours to Spirit Island, kayaking, and hiking.
  • Columbia Icefield: The Columbia Icefield is a massive icefield that covers an area of 325 square kilometers. Visitors can take a guided tour to the Athabasca Glacier, which is the most accessible glacier in the Canadian Rockies.
  • Athabasca Falls: This powerful waterfall is located in the heart of Jasper National Park and is a must-visit for anyone traveling to the area.
  • Jasper SkyTram: Take a ride on the Jasper SkyTram to the top of Whistler Mountain for panoramic views of Jasper and the surrounding area.
  • Wildlife Viewing: Jasper National Park is home to a variety of wildlife, including elk, deer, moose, bighorn sheep, mountain goats, wolves, bears, and more. Take a wildlife tour or explore on your own to catch a glimpse of these magnificent creatures.
  • Hiking: Jasper National Park has over 1,000 kilometers of hiking trails for all skill levels. Some popular hikes include the Valley of the Five Lakes Trail, the Maligne Canyon Trail, and the Bald Hills Trail.
  • Miette Hot Springs: Relax in the natural hot springs at Miette Hot Springs, located in the heart of Jasper National Park.
  • Jasper Townsite: Explore the charming town of Jasper, with its unique shops, restaurants, and galleries.
